What is the PCB layout of a solar inverter?
The printed circuit board (PCB) layout of a solar inverter is a critical aspect of its design, as it affects the overall performance and efficiency of the inverter. The PCB layout of a solar inverter involves the placement and routing of components on the board to minimize noise and optimize the flow of current.
What are inverter PCB boards?
Inverter PCB boards are found across a wide spectrum of modern technologies: Solar Power Systems: Convert solar DC output to usable AC for grid or household use. Electric Vehicles (EVs): Manage power flow between battery packs and motors. Industrial Motor Drives: Enable speed and torque control in machinery.
